AET BioTech was a biosimilars-focused biotechnology business within the Alfred E. Tiefenbacher Group, with operations referenced in Hamburg, Germany and Malta. The company positioned itself as an independent developer and supplier of biosimilars for branded marketing partners in regulated and emerging markets. Its most visible disclosed program was a biosimilar version of adalimumab (Humira), developed with BioXpress Therapeutics using monoclonal antibody biosimilar technology. Public evidence suggests the Malta legal entity, AET Biotechnology Limited, was later struck off, and AET BioTech does not appear to operate today as an active standalone company.
